Job Description

Helping People. Changing Lives. Under the direction of the Food Services Manager develops and implements quality improvement programs, researches and develops training opportunities, reviews kitchen reporting logs and monitors child care centers for compliance in the Child & Adult Care Food Program (CACFP). Supports the development of the food services program across multiple counties. Supports CAPSLO's mission by ensuring the multiple county Child & Adult Care Food Program runs smoothly by encouraging quality improvement, training opportunities, maintaining compliance in all kitchens so the program can serve as many families and individuals as possible within the community. What you bring to the table: Bachelor's Degree with two years education or work experience in nutrition, food processing or early childhood education. Experience developing and giving presentations to groups. Solid evidence of strong organizational skills. Experience collaborating on projects and contributing ideas. Fluency in two or more languages, including one that supports the needs of the program and community is preferred, but not required As a Quality Development Specialist you will: Perform site monitoring of meal service, kitchen safety and sanitation, and Farm to Preschool activities. Develop and implement quality improvement initiatives that support USDA efforts to enhance child nutrition and healthy eating habits, including expanding kitchen staff skills and integrating Farm to Preschool curriculum. Research, design, and deliver training opportunities for kitchen staff, including both one-on-one coaching and group sessions. Support cooks in developing computer proficiency and effectively using food program software. Track and monitor monthly child care center kitchen reporting submissions; communicate with sites regarding missing information and ensure timely follow-up. Conduct routine audits of attendance records and meal counts to ensure accuracy and compliance. Promote environmentally responsible practices within the food program by supporting efforts to reduce, reuse, and recycle resources. Maintain up-to-date knowledge of program regulations and requirements, and assist in implementing new guidelines with relevant staff. Support the Food Services Manager with a variety of tasks to ensure efficient and effective program operations. Perform other related duties as assigned.
